About flights from Jakar (BUT)

Bathpalathang Airport serves the Bumthang valley at roughly 2,600 meters elevation, which tells you immediately that this isn't your standard regional hop. The runway situation here is genuinely dramatic — short, high-altitude, surrounded by mountains, and operated by Druk Air under conditions that would make a lot of pilots sweat. One route. One destination. That's the entire network. For travelers who've spent time chasing obscure IATA codes, BUT has a certain purity to it that more connected airports simply can't offer. Flying in or out feels like a logistical event rather than a transaction. You notice the silence, the cold clarity of the air, the absence of the usual airport noise machine.

Why fly to Jakar?

The single route connecting Bathpalathang to Paro (PBH) covers just 132 kilometers, but don't let that fool you into thinking it's inconsequential. The alternative is a road trip through mountain passes that can take the better part of a day depending on conditions and season. Bumthang itself is considered by many Bhutanese to be the spiritual heartland of the country — home to some of the oldest temples and dzongs in the kingdom. Tourists who make it this far east of Paro are genuinely committed. The flight gives access to Jakar Dzong, the Jambay Lhakhang festival (held in autumn), and valley walks that see a fraction of the visitor numbers that the western regions attract.

Tips for travelers at BUT

Druk Air operates this route, and schedules are thin — check current timetables carefully because frequency can be limited to a handful of weekly departures at best. Weather cancellations happen; build buffer days into your itinerary because the mountain flying conditions here aren't negotiable. The airport sits close to Jakar town, so ground transport is straightforward. Dress for cold even in shoulder seasons given the altitude. Bhutan's tourism policy means you're already traveling with a licensed operator if you're here legally, so lean on them for real-time flight updates rather than relying on third-party apps.

Frequently asked questions about flying to Jakar

How do I get from Bathpalathang Airport to Jakar city center?

The airport is only about 15 minutes from Jakar town, so you can easily arrange a taxi through your hotel or a local tour operator for a reasonable fare, or rent a car if you're comfortable driving on Bhutan's winding mountain roads.

What's the best time to fly to Jakar?

The ideal seasons are spring (March-May) and fall (September-November) when the weather is clear and stable, making for smoother flights and better visibility of the stunning Himalayan landscapes.

How many direct destinations can I reach from Bathpalathang Airport?

Bathpalathang Airport has just 1 direct destination, so most travelers will connect through Paro International Airport, which is Bhutan's main international hub.

What are the visa requirements for entering Bhutan through this airport?

Most visitors need to book through a licensed Bhutanese tour operator and obtain a visa, which they'll arrange for you—you can't just show up; it's all part of Bhutan's sustainable tourism policy.

What should I know about the airport itself?

Bathpalathang is a small, high-altitude airport at over 10,000 feet, so flights can be weather-dependent and occasionally delayed; arrive early and be flexible with your schedule.

Is flying to Jakar expensive compared to flying to Paro?

Flights to Jakar tend to be pricier than Paro since there's limited capacity and only one route, so booking in advance and considering a Paro arrival with an overland drive to Jakar might save you money.
